Delegation from the Indonesian Embassy Visits BIBB
The Chargé d'Affaires of the Indonesian Embassy and his delegation visited the BIBB offices in Bonn to learn more about Germany’s dual vocational training system. They also exchanged views on BIBB’s advisory work in Indonesia. It was a lively and stimulating discussion throughout.
On Friday, 13 June, Mr Fajar Wirawan Harijo, Chargé d'Affaires of the Indonesian Embassy, visited BIBB accompanied by his Cultural Attaché and the heads of the Press and Culture Departments. The purpose of their visit was to gain deeper insights into the dual system and explore BIBB’s ongoing activities in Indonesia. The visitors showed great interest in how the system operates in Germany and were especially impressed by the strong engagement of German companies. The vibrant exchange of ideas even sparked initial plans for future collaboration.
The BIBB team shared its expertise from advisory projects it has been implementing on behalf of BMZ and GIZ since 2019. These projects focus on governance structures, the development of a vocational education and training strategy, and – currently, in particular – on curriculum development for a sustainable economy.
The next meeting between BIBB and the Indonesian Embassy is already planned: On 3 July, a group of BIBB trainees will visit the embassy in Berlin as part of their educational trip. They will speak with embassy staff about current topics related to Indonesia and German-Indonesian cooperation.
